CARY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2024 in Review
52 of the 7,592 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Angel Oak Income ETF (CARY) for Q4 2024, worth a combined $308M — up 14% from $271M a quarter earlier.
Buyers outnumbered sellers: 13 funds opened new CARY positions and 3 closed out — a net gain of 10 holders — while 26 added to existing stakes and 8 trimmed.
The largest buyer was L.J. Altfest & Co, opening a new position worth an estimated $7.44M. The largest seller was Proficio Capital Partners, exiting entirely with an estimated $1.23M sold.
